A quick and easy healthy snack of frozen seedless grapes that offers a refreshing, guilt-free treat perfect for summer and pool days.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ups (300 grams) seedless grapes (green, red, or black)
  • Optional: 1 teaspoon lemon juice
  • Optional: 1 teaspoon honey or agave syrup

Instructions

  1. Wash and dry the grapes thoroughly. Rinse 2 cups (300 grams) of seedless grapes under cold water. Pat them completely dry with a clean kitchen towel or paper towels.
  2. Optional: Toss grapes with lemon juice and sweetener. In a mixing bowl, combine grapes with 1 teaspoon of fresh lemon juice and, if desired, 1 teaspoon of honey or agave syrup. Stir gently to coat evenly.
  3. Arrange grapes on a parchment-lined baking sheet in a single layer, making sure none are touching to prevent clumping.
  4. Freeze grapes for 3-4 hours or until solid. Place the tray flat in the freezer.
  5. Transfer frozen grapes to a freezer-safe container or resealable plastic bag once solid.
  6. Serve immediately from the freezer or store for later. If grapes soften, refreeze for 10-15 minutes before serving.

Notes

Pick firm, ripe seedless grapes and dry them thoroughly to prevent sticking. Freeze grapes in a single layer to avoid clumping. Do not thaw before eating to maintain crunch. Store in airtight container for up to 3 months, best within 1 month.
